The Fórum Algirós is an initiative of the VCF Foundation that brings the Club’s history closer to all Valencianistas through its protagonists.
On a regular basis, the Foundation organises meetings linked to relevant milestones from the 107 years of existence, as well as to other topics related to sport and society in general. To date, 22 Fórums have been held:
Conexión Vintage: Kempes, on February 26, 2016 at the Centro Cultural Bancaja, with the participation of: the legendary players Kempes, Arias and Felman; and the journalists Paco Grande and Paco Lloret.
Bronco y Copero. 75 años de la primera Copa, on May 5, 2016 at the MuVIM, with the participation of: Pepe Vaello, distinguished Valencianista; Josep Bosch, historian; and the journalists José Ricardo March and Alfonso Gil.
In the 2nd Fórum Algirós, Valencia CF and the Foundation also wished to pay tribute to Josep Rodríguez Tortajada (1899-1982), Club president during the Civil War (1936-1939), through his adopted son Francesc Cueva, who was awarded the Club’s gold and diamond badge by Juan Cruz Sol, member of the Club Advisory Board.
Blanquinegre. A 90 minuts de la glòria, on October 4, 2016 in the interior square of Nuevo Centro, with the participation of: the great players Roberto Gil, Juan Cruz Sol and Miguel Tendillo, who recalled the titles won by the Club between 1941 and 1981; and the journalist Alfonso Gil.
Claramunt. 50 anys del debut d’un mite, on November 24, 2016 at the Cultural Sports Complex La Petxina of the Municipal Sports Foundation, with the participation of: the great Pepe Claramunt and his teammates Abelardo and Sergio Manzanera; and the journalists Alfredo Relaño and Paco Lloret.
L’equip elèctric. 75 anys de la primera Lliga, on February 16, 2017 in the VIP Box of Mestalla, with the participation of: the daughter of Mundo, Rosa Suárez; Rafael Bau, grandson of Rafael Bau García, board member of the era; and the journalists José Ricardo March and Alfonso Gil.
In the 5th Fórum Algirós, the Foundation announced it would request that Valencia CF officially recognise Rafael Bau García as president, a position he held from June 28, 1936 for 47 days. This recognition was officially confirmed in October 2017.
